Overview: The Zumbrota Economic Development Authority (EDA) meeting focused on the potential sale of a commercial property at 525 22nd Street, as members debated the adequacy of an offer to purchase the land, which has been listed since 2010. Meanwhile, the sale of 550 22nd Street to PNK Graphics progressed smoothly, and attendees received updates on local projects, including the on-schedule KB Apartments development.

Overview: The Miami Beach Finance and Economic Resiliency Committee convened to tackle pressing budgetary challenges, focusing on potential reductions and allocations while maintaining essential services amid economic uncertainty. Significant discussions revolved around addressing a substantial budget gap, considering millage rate adjustments, and the implications of various proposed cuts on public safety, cultural programming, and city services.

Overview: The Zumbrota Economic Development Authority (EDA) meeting focused on topics, including the sale of city property, budget constraints due to a new public pool, and potential changes in local business landscapes. The meeting also touched on marketing strategies involving artificial intelligence, and the complexities of city-owned alleyways. Members examined ways to sustain economic growth while addressing community needs.

Overview: In a recent meeting, the New Ulm Economic Development Authority (EDA) approved the relocation of a utility cabinet to avoid cutting down two large maple trees on their property on North Broadway.

Overview: The Miami Beach Finance and Economic Resiliency Committee convened to discuss several key items, including the extension of a professional services agreement with Paddle LLC, a proposed new agreement with the Greater Miami Convention and Visitors Bureau (GMCVB), and updates on various city projects. Central to the meeting was the debate over restructuring the GMCVB’s compensation model, potentially shifting from a fixed to a sliding scale based on resort tax collections.
